As the UK's only bespoke rooflight manufacturer that supplies a specific layout for both dealt with and opening rooflights we frequently obtain asked what concerning the advantages and disadvantages of each. As a noticeable starting point the only genuine drawbacks to a fixed style is lack of air flow and/or the capability to access the roofing system.
Examine This Report about Rooflights
We will provide a manual option approximately around 1000mm (w) x 1500mm (h) or 1350mm (w) x 1100mm (h). Anything beyond these dimensions and the winder will certainly start to have issues with the casement weight and the capability to tightly shut the corners. Remembering that Stella usage exceptionally premium quality and durable British made strong brass winders, where numerous other makers commonly use cheaper, and Full Article significantly lower top quality imports, it's well worth inspecting what your rooflight maker suggests as an optimum dimension for a manually operated rooflight.
Our bespoke Stella preservation rooflight page operates with a little cill installed actuator to press the sash open. As the sash size and weight increases, so does the number of drives needed to lift it, so there is a compromise in that bigger solitary casements use a lot more light yet they are much more expensive to operate.
The basic colour for the actuator box is RAL9006 White Aluminium although we can colour code to any kind of RAL colour of your selection. The drives that we use are solid, durable and neat however periodically we are asked if there is a means of opening our rooflights without seeing the drives.

This does result in a mild reduction in clear readable area however leaves the cill area clear of any disturbance. The drives have various chain sizes and would typically be anticipated to attain an opening range of around 350mm.
